Claims (20)
- a.遠位端及び近位端を有するステムと、
b.前記遠位端に配置されるアンカ用インジケータと、
c.前記アンカ用インジケータの基部に配置されるバルーンと、
を備えるバルブプランニングツールであって、
前記バルーンが、
i.収縮状態と、
ii.展開状態とを含み、
前記バルーンを前記収縮状態から前記展開状態へと膨張させることができ、かつ前記バルーンが、実質的にノンコンプライアントであり、そのため、前記バルーンは単一サイズに膨張できるのみである、
ことを特徴とするバルブプランニングツール。 - 前記バルーンが圧縮性流体により膨張させることができる、
ことを特徴とする請求項1に記載のバルブプランニングツール。 - 前記圧縮性流体が空気である、
ことを特徴とする請求項2に記載のバルブプランニングツール。 - 前記バルーンが、ポリエーテル、ポリエーテルブロックアミド、ポリアミド、ポリエチレンテレフタレート、熱可塑性樹脂、ポリエステル、低伸縮性プラスチック、低伸縮性生体適合性プラスチック、非弾性プラスチック、非伸縮性プラスチック、又はこれらの組み合わせでできている、
ことを特徴とする請求項1〜3のいずれか1項に記載のバルブプランニングツール。 - 前記バルーンがバルブの封止部位を実質的に表す封止領域インジケータを備え、
前記封止領域インジケータは前記バルブが封止できる気道の断面長の範囲を示す、
ことを特徴とする請求項1〜4のいずれか1項に記載のバルブプランニングツール。 - 前記封止領域インジケータの直径と、前記バルブが封止できる最大の気道直径とが実質的に同一である、
ことを特徴とする請求項5に記載のバルブプランニングツール。 - 前記バルーンが、楕円形、ダイヤモンド形、円形、凧形、2つを背中合わせにしたピラミッド形、又はそれらの組み合わせである長手方向軸に沿う断面を有する、
ことを特徴とする請求項1〜6のいずれか1項に記載のバルブプランニングツール。 - 前記バルーンが、約4mm以上、約5mm以上、約6mm以上、約7mm以上、約12mm以下、又は約10mm以下の外径を有する、
ことを特徴とする請求項1〜7のいずれか1項に記載のバルブプランニングツール。 - 前記アンカ用インジケータが1つ以上の突起部を備え、
前記1つ以上の突起部がアンカの振りの広がりを可視化できるように収縮状態から展開状態へと移行できる、
ことを特徴とする請求項1〜8のいずれか1項に記載のバルブプランニングツール。 - 前記アンカ用インジケータが1つ以上の突起部を備え、
前記1つ以上の突起部が静止している、
ことを特徴とする請求項1〜8のいずれか1項に記載のバルブプランニングツール。 - 前記1つ以上の突起部から前記バルーンの封止範囲インジケータまでの長さが、バルブの長さに相当する、
ことを特徴とする請求項9又は10に記載のバルブプランニングツール。 - 前記バルブプランニングツールが、前記突起部から前記バルブプランニングツールの前記遠位端に延在する長さインジケータを備える、
ことを特徴とする請求項1〜11のいずれか1項に記載のバルブプランニングツール。 - 請求項1〜12のいずれか1項に記載のバルブプランニングツールを2つ以上含むキット。
- 前記2つ以上のバルブプランニングツールにおける第1のバルブプランニングツールが、前記キットの第2のバルブプランニングツールよりも、長い長さ、大きな直径、短い長さ、小さな直径、又はそれらの組み合わせを有する、
ことを特徴とする請求項13に記載のキット。 - 前記キットが異なる寸法の4つのバルブプランニングツールを含む、
ことを特徴とする請求項13又は14に記載のキット。 - 第1のバルブプランニングツールが約5mmの封止領域インジケータ直径、約8mmのアンカ用インジケータ直径、及び約10mmの長さを有し、
第2のバルブプランニングツールが約6mmの封止領域インジケータ直径、約9mmのアンカ用インジケータ直径、及び約11mmの長さを有し、
第3のバルブプランニングツールが約7mmの封止領域インジケータ直径、約10mmのアンカ用インジケータ直径、及び約12mmの長さを有し、
第4のバルブプランニングツールが、約9mmの封止領域インジケータ直径、約12mmのアンカ用インジケータ直径、及び約12mmの長さを有する、
ことを特徴とする請求項13〜15に記載のキット。 - a.請求項1〜12のいずれかに記載のバルブプランニングツールをコンパクト化して収縮状態にすることと、
b.バルブプランニングツールを気管支鏡の使用チャネルに挿入することと、
を含むことを特徴とする方法。 - 前記バルブプランニングツールが目的の領域を有する構造体に挿入され、
前記バルブプランニングツールが気管支鏡の前記チャネルから撤収される、
ことを特徴とする請求項17に記載の方法。 - 前記バルブプランニングツールが目的の前記領域内で前記収縮状態から展開状態に移行するように、前記バルブプランニングツールが膨張させられ、
前記バルブプランニングツールの構造が前記構造体よりも大きいか、又は小さいかを決定するために前記構造体と比較される、
ことを特徴とする請求項18に記載の方法。 - 前記構造体が前記バルブプランニングツールよりも大きいか又は小さい場合に、前記方法が、より大きい又はより小さいバルブプランニングツールにより繰り返される、
ことを特徴とする請求項19に記載の方法。
